The problem = is, of course, that you're trying to do something explicitly in Lojban that is done /implicitly/ in the English phrase "Would you= =20 like coffee or tea?" {.i do djica tu'a loi ckafi ji loi tcati}
=
It should be noted that even in the English question, "both" = and "neither" are=20 still acceptable -though uncommon- answers. There is nothing about the Engl= ish question that forbids a choice of "both" or "neither&quo= t;, it is merely social customs that makes such answers verboten.

This very thing is talked about in the logical connectives section of the C= LL.

ht= tp://dag.github.io/cll/14/13/

It's also been discussed= quite a bit in the tiki:

http://www.lojban.org/tiki/Do+you+want+coffee+or+tea%3F<= br>
Basically, the gist is, if you want someone to choose amongst = a set of mutually exclusive items, and you're using OR, you're aski= ng the wrong question.

What you should be saying in such situations is more akin to: &qu= ot;Choose one of: coffee, tea"

.i.e'u cuxna lo pamei lo cka= fi .e lo tcati
You shouldn't have logical &q= uot;and" there; I concede that the irrealis attitudinal scope can be a= rgued to fix it, but it's more weird than it needs to be. {.e'o cux= na pa da lo ckafi ce lo tcati} (or, in the idiom that doesn't think set= s matter in everyday discourse, {.e'o cuxna pa da lo ckafi joi lo tcati= }).
